Red Hawks Improve Postseason Chances With Sweep of Monmouth

RIPON, Wis. - The Red Hawks moved into a third-place tie in the Midwest Conference standings Wednesday afternoon, defeating Monmouth 1-0 and 3-1 to complete a sweep of the Fighting Scots. Ripon has now won eight of their last nine games, which marks the first time they've accomplished that feat since the 2012 season. They have also won 11 of their last 13 contests.

The day's first game featured a pitcher's duel that saw the only run come in the bottom of the fourth inning when a one-out single by Brooke Bauer scored Lexi Reetz from third base.

With Ripon leading 1-0, Reetz took it from there, allowing just two hits the rest of the game, en route to her fifth shutout of the season. She also struck out five batters, while allowing just five hits in the game.

Monmouth's Liz Hippen (10-6) also pitched well in the loss, allowing one run on seven hits and striking out four.

In the nightcap, Ripon (16-16, 10-4 MWC) completed the sweep with a 3-1 victory, despite falling behind 1-0 after Monmouth (17-15, 6-8 MWC) recorded an RBI double in the top of the fourth. Ripon answered with a run in the bottom of that inning when Reetz scored on an RBI single to right field by Julia Sanchez.

One inning later, Ripon took the lead on an RBI single by Micaela Encarnacion, before adding an insurance run on an RBI groundout, allowing Kayley Grabowski to score.

Lilli Smith started and allowed one run on six hits while striking out two, before giving way to Reetz (13-7), who earned the win by pitching 2.1 scoreless innings of relief, allowing just one hit and striking out two. With seven strikeouts on the day, Reetz becomes just the third player in program history to record more than 100 strikeouts in three different seasons. Her 13 victories currently place her in a fourth-place tie in school history for a single season, three shy of the school record.

Ripon will continue its quest for a spot in the four-team MWC Tournament this weekend when they'll travel to Janesville, Wis. on Saturday to battle Illinois College, which is currently in second place in the MWC standings.
